Judge blocks fees set by tainted bailout law | News, Sports, Jobs

Dec 22, 2020 COLUMBUS (AP) A central Ohio judge on Monday blocked the subsidies from a $1 billion nuclear bailout law at the center of a $60 million bribery probe, as state lawmakers scrambled to decide the fate of a repeal effort and nominees were chosen to succeed a utility regulator who resigned amid the investigation. Franklin County Judge Chris Brown sided with Republican Attorney General Dave Yost and the cities of Cincinnati and Columbus in granting a preliminary injunction that would block the subsidies that were set to be added to every electric bill in the state starting Jan. 1. “Today’s ruling is a win for all Ohioans,” Columbus City Attorney Zach Klein said in a statement. “HB 6 was passed through deceit, deception and corruption and this decision means that Ohio ratepayers will keep their hard-earned dollars instead of paying for a massive corporate bailout.”

Four Candidates Make the List to Replace PUCO Chair Who Resigned Last Month

/ A pic of then-PUCO Chair Sam Randazzo speaking to a crowd of industry stakeholders and experts at the 24th Annual Ohio Energy Management Conference , shared by the PUCO Twitter account in February 2020. The list of possible successors to take over as chair of the Public Utilities Commission of Ohio has been narrowed to four. One will succeed Sam Randazzo, who resigned last month after a federal filing from FirstEnergy noting an improper $4 million payment to an entity associated with someone who became a state regulator. The Public Utilities Commission of Ohio Nominating Council has submitted four names from a list of interested candidates to Gov. Mike DeWine to replace Randazzo. They are Angela Amos, Anne Vogel, Greg Poulos and Judith French.
